The image displays two full-body illustrations of figures standing side by side. Both individuals are depicted in a theatrical or cavalier style, with their bodies angled slightly forward and to the side. The facial features of both figures are drawn with an exaggerated, comical style, and they have wavy hair peeking out from under wide-brimmed hats adorned with plumes. Their clothing consists of voluminous trousers that taper at the knee, accompanied by cloaks draped over their shoulders. Each figure wears a hat with feathers, and they carry a sword. The background of the image is plain.
